Is it Safe To Run A Refrigerator On A Generator?

Yes, it’s generally safe to run a refrigerator on a generator. However, it would help if you took certain precautions.

First, ensure that your generator has sufficient capacity. Refrigerators require a power surge to start the compressor, which is higher than the running wattage.

Next, consider the quality of your generator. Some models might produce unstable power, potentially harmful to your fridge. A generator with inverter technology is a good choice. It delivers clean and stable power and is safe for sensitive electronics.

Also, consider the duration of the power outage. Refrigerators can keep food cold for about four hours without power if the door is unopened. For longer power outages, you’ll need to power the refrigerator.

Finally, remember not to overload your generator. It may not effectively power your fridge if it’s powering other heavy appliances simultaneously. Always check your generator’s total capacity.

To sum up, you can run a fridge on a generator. But you must be careful. Choose a generator that meets the fridge’s power demands, provides stable power, and is not overloaded.

What Size Generator Is Needed To Run A Refrigerator?

Determining the right generator size for your refrigerator requires some calculations. First, check the starting and running wattage of your fridge. These specifications are usually found on the appliance’s label.

For most refrigerators, the starting wattage ranges from 800 to 1200 watts, while the running wattage is around 150 watts. But remember, these values can vary based on the fridge’s size and model.

A generator’s capacity is measured in watts. So, it would help to have a generator that can handle your refrigerator’s maximum wattage demand.

Consider a fridge requiring 1200 watts to start and 150 watts to run. In this case, a generator with a capacity of about 1500 watts should suffice.

However, calculate their total wattage if you plan to power other appliances simultaneously. Include this in your generator size determination.

For instance, if you intend to power your fridge and a 500-watt AC unit, you’ll need a generator with a minimum capacity of 2000 watts.

Therefore, knowing the total wattage of all appliances to be powered is crucial. This ensures you choose a generator that can handle the combined load without overloading.

In conclusion, the size of the generator to run a refrigerator depends on its wattage and other appliances to be powered.

Can A Generator Damage A Refrigerator?

Yes, a generator can potentially damage a refrigerator. This typically occurs due to power fluctuations or surges.

Generators, especially lower-quality models, can have inconsistent power outputs. If the power supply isn’t stable, it can harm the refrigerator’s compressor.

The compressor is the fridge’s heart. It’s responsible for the refrigeration cycle. If this component gets damaged, the entire refrigerator might stop working.

Moreover, sudden power surges can also cause harm. If the generator produces a voltage spike, it can lead to electrical damage. This is particularly damaging to the fridge’s electronic components.

To protect your fridge, consider a generator with inverter technology. Inverter generators are designed to produce power with minimal harmonic distortion. This ensures a smooth, steady power supply, which is safer for your fridge.

Another option is using a surge protector. These devices can shield your refrigerator from sudden voltage spikes. They do this by either blocking or shorting to ground any unwanted voltages.

While a generator can power a fridge, care must be taken. Select a quality generator, consider a surge protector, and ensure stable power output. This way, you can effectively run your fridge without damaging it.
